In the diagram AB is parallel to CD. AED and BEC are straight lines. Prove that triangle ABE is similar to triangle CDE.

Step 1

Prove that angles are equal: ∠ABE and ∠CDE

Since AB is parallel to CD and AE and BE are transversals, by the Alternate Interior Angles Theorem, we have:

ABE=CDE∠ABE = ∠CDE.

Step 2

Prove that angles are equal: ∠BAE and ∠ECD

Similarly, since AB is parallel to CD, we can use the same theorem. Thus:

BAE=ECD∠BAE = ∠ECD.

Step 3

Establish the similarity of the triangles

Since we have shown that:

ABE=CDE∠ABE = ∠CDE BAE=ECD∠BAE = ∠ECD,

it follows that triangles ABE and CDE have two pairs of angles equal. Therefore, by the Angle-Angle (AA) criterion, triangles ABE and CDE are similar:

ABECDE\triangle ABE \sim \triangle CDE.
